Sunday, June 8, 2025
ModernCryptoNews.com
  • Crypto
  • NFTs & Metaverse
  • DeFi
ModernCryptoNews.com
No Result
View All Result

The Ethereum Development Process | Ethereum Foundation Blog

April 18, 2024
Reading Time: 2 mins read
0

[ad_1]

RELATED POSTS

Will Bitcoin ETF flows turn negative again? What’s causing market jitters

Institutions Bullish on Ethereum despite Low Demand for Spot Ether ETFs

Price Rises Above Downward Trendline And Key MA Levels

So I am undecided if this type of growth methodology has ever been utilized to such an excessive earlier than so I figured I would doc it. In a nutshell, it is form of like test-driven triplet-programming growth.

Whereas speed-developing our alpha codebase, 4 of us sat round a desk within the workplace in Berlin. Three individuals (Vitalik, Jeff and me) every coders of their very own clean-room implementation of the Ethereum protocol. The fourth was Christoph, our grasp of testing.

Our goal was to have three totally appropriate implementations in addition to an unambiguous specification by the top of three days of considerable growth. Over distance, this course of usually takes just a few weeks.

This time we would have liked to expedite it; our course of was fairly easy. First we talk about the varied consensus-breaking adjustments and formally describe them as finest we will. Then, individually we every crack on coding up the adjustments concurrently, popping our heads up about attainable clarifications to the specs as wanted. In the meantime, Christoph devises and codes checks, populating the outcomes both manually or with the farthest-ahead of the implementations (C++, typically :-P).

After a milestone’s price of adjustments are coded up and the checks written, every clean-room implementation is examined towards the widespread take a look at knowledge that Christoph compiled. The place points are discovered, we debug in a gaggle. Up to now, this has proved to be an efficient means of manufacturing well-tested code rapidly, and maybe extra importantly, in delivering clear unambiguous formal specs.

Are there any extra examples of such methods taken to the acute?

[ad_2]

Source link

Tags: BlogdevelopmentEthereumFoundationProcess
wpadministrator

wpadministrator

Next Post

BlockDAG Rises with $18.2M Presale, Surpassing Ethereum and New Cryptos

Injective and Jambo partner to bring mobile-based DeFi to millions in emerging markets

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

No Result
View All Result

Categories

  • Altcoins
  • Bitcoin
  • Blockchain
  • Cryptocurrency
  • DeFI
  • Dogecoin
  • Ethereum
  • Market & Analysis
  • NFTs
  • Regulations
  • Xrp

Recommended

  • XRP Network Activity Jumps 67% In 24 Hours – Big Move Ahead?
  • Crypto Industry Contributed $18 Million To Trump’s Inauguration, Ripple Among The Top Donors
  • XRP Tops Weekly Crypto Inflows Despite Market Volatility – The Crypto Times
  • XRP Price Could Soar to $2.4 as Investors Eye Two Crucial Dates
  • XRP Eyes $2.35 Breakout, But $1.80 Breakdown Threatens Bearish Shift – TronWeekly

© 2023 Modern Crypto News | All Rights Reserved

No Result
View All Result
  • Crypto
  • NFTs & Metaverse
  • DeFi

© 2023 Modern Crypto News | All Rights Reserved